Industrial Welfare Commission Wage Orders define “split shift” as a work schedule which is interrupted by non-paid non-working periods established by the employer, other than “bona fide” rest or meal periods. Only non-exempt hourly Employees are eligible for a Split-Shift Premium. Work must be completed within 12 hours from the start of the shift. The Division of Labor Standards Enforcement (“DLSE”), in its 12/11/2002 Opinion Letter “Hours Worked-Split-Shift”, has taken the position that a “bonafide” meal period is one that does not exceed one-hour (60 minutes) in length. A split shift is defined as “a schedule of daily hours in which the working hours required or permitted are not consecutive,” while no meal period of one hour or less shall be considered an interruption of consecutive hours.
